Huawei has unveiled the Vision Smart Screen 5 SE, a distinctive entry in the smart TV market that integrates advanced technology with user-friendly features. This new model stands out with its built-in camera, enabling seamless video calls and introducing motion-controlled gaming experiences reminiscent of early interactive gaming consoles. The inclusion of such features reflects Huawei's commitment to blending functionality with innovative entertainment options.
At the heart of the Vision Smart Screen 5 SE lies a mini-LED display, delivering a stunning 4K resolution of 3840 x 2160 pixels. The screen supports a native refresh rate of 120Hz, which can be dynamically boosted to 240Hz through interpolation, ensuring smooth and fluid motion handling. In HDR mode, the television achieves a peak brightness of up to 1000 nits, coupled with an impressive dynamic contrast ratio of 125,000:1. These specifications promise vibrant colors and deep blacks, enhancing the overall viewing experience for both movies and gaming.
Running on HarmonyOS 4.3, the Vision Smart Screen 5 SE offers robust connectivity options, including multiple HDMI ports for linking gaming consoles or external media players, an Ethernet port for stable wired internet connections, and built-in Wi-Fi for wireless streaming. The operating system is further enhanced by AI-powered features, which aim to optimize content delivery and user interaction based on intelligent algorithms. This integration of AI ensures that the television adapts to user preferences, providing a more personalized viewing experience.
Available in three sizes—55, 65, and 75 inches—the Vision Smart Screen 5 SE caters to a range of room sizes and user needs. Starting at $384, the pricing positions it competitively within the smart TV landscape, particularly given its high-end display technology and feature set. Currently launched in the Chinese market, there is anticipation about potential global availability, although initial reports suggest a limited release outside China in the near future.
